Cemented carbide mould

Cold heading is one of the advanced machining processes with less and no cutting. It has the characteristics of high production efficiency, energy saving, material saving, improved mechanical strength and precision of parts, and suitable for mass automated production. It has been widely used. In my country, the main cold heading process Used in fasteners, rolling bearings, roller chains, auto parts, military industry and other industries.

The cold heading forming of the parts is carried out on the cold heading machine.

1. Steel for cold heading dies under general load

The general load cold working die is mainly used for the production of cold heading parts with less complicated shapes, not too large deformation, and cold heading speed. The cold heading parts produced are low carbon steel or medium and low carbon steel parts.

2. Steel for heavy-duty cold heading die

The heavy-duty cold heading die is used to produce cold heading parts with large deformation and more complicated shapes. The cold heading parts use alloy steel or medium-high carbon steel with higher steel strength.

3. Steel for new type cold heading die

my country has introduced foreign steel grades or independently developed more than 10 new steel grades suitable for manufacturing cold heading dies. These new steel grades are characterized by high hardenability and hardenability, high compression yield point, and Good wear resistance and toughness.
